2013 European Youth Summer Olympic Festival
![]() | |
Host city | Utrecht, Netherlands |
---|---|
Nations participating | 49 |
Athletes participating | 2,300 |
Events | 111 |
Opening ceremony | 14 July 2013 |
Closing ceremony | 19 July 2013 |
Officially opened by | King Willem Alexander |
Athlete's Oath | Aafke Soet |
Coach's Oath | Saskia van Hintum |
Torch lighter | Max Geesink |
Main venue | Galgenwaard Stadium |
The 2013 European Youth Summer Olympic Festival was held in Utrecht, Netherlands, between 14 and 19 July 2013.[1][2]

Venues
Venue | Location | Sports |
---|---|---|
Jaarbeurs Utrecht | Utrecht | Handball, volleyball, judo |
Het Lint | Leidsche Rijn | Cycling |
Galgenwaard Sports Centre | Utrecht | Gymnastics |
Maarschalkerweerd | Utrecht | Athletics |
Den Hommel Tennis Park | Utrecht | Tennis |
De Krommerijn Swimming Pool | Utrecht | Swimming |
Olympic Sports Centre | Utrecht | Basketball |
